Freigeben über


IShellFolderSearchable::FindString-Methode

Startet eine Suche nach einer angegebenen Suchzeichenfolge.

Syntax

HRESULT FindString(
  [in]  LPCWSTR      pwszTarget,
  [in]  DWORD        *pdwFlags,
  [in]  IUnknown     *punkOnAsyncSearch,
  [out] LPITEMIDLIST ppidlOut
);

Parameter

pwszTarget [in]

Typ: LPCWSTR

Ein Zeiger auf eine Zeichenfolge, die die such-Schlüsselwort (keyword) angibt.

pdwFlags [in]

Typ: DWORD*

Derzeit sind keine Flags definiert. auf NULL festgelegt.

punkOnAsyncSearch [in]

Typ: IUnknown*

Ein Zeiger auf ein Objekt vom Typ IUnknown. Dieses Objekt muss die IShellFolderSearchableCallback-Schnittstelle unterstützen. Legen Sie auf NULL fest, wenn kein Rückruf erforderlich ist.

ppidlOut [out]

Typ: LPITEMIDLIST

Ein Zeiger auf eine ITEMIDLIST-Struktur für den Suchordner.

Rückgabewert

Typ: HRESULT

Wenn diese Methode erfolgreich ist, wird S_OK zurückgegeben. Andernfalls wird ein HRESULT-Fehlercode zurückgegeben.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client)
Windows 2000 Professional [nur Desktop-Apps]
Unterstützte Mindestversion (Server)
Windows 2000 Server [nur Desktop-Apps]
Header
Mmc.h
DLL
Shell32.dll